package resourcegraph
import (
"context"
"io"
"net/http"
"strings"
"testing"
"time"
"github.com/google/go-cmp/cmp"
"github.com/google/go-cmp/cmp/cmpopts"
"github.com/grafana/grafana-plugin-sdk-go/backend"
"github.com/grafana/grafana-plugin-sdk-go/data"
"github.com/stretchr/testify/assert"
"github.com/stretchr/testify/require"
"github.com/grafana/grafana/pkg/tsdb/azuremonitor/loganalytics"
"github.com/grafana/grafana/pkg/tsdb/azuremonitor/types"
)
func TestBuildingAzureResourceGraphQueries(t *testing.T) {
datasource := &AzureResourceGraphDatasource{}
fromStart := time.Date(2018, 3, 15, 13, 0, 0, 0, time.UTC).In(time.Local)
tests := []struct {
name string
queryModel []backend.DataQuery
timeRange backend.TimeRange
azureResourceGraphQueries []*AzureResourceGraphQuery
Err require.ErrorAssertionFunc
}{
{
name: "Query with macros should be interpolated",
timeRange: backend.TimeRange{
From: fromStart,
To: fromStart.Add(34 * time.Minute),
},
queryModel: []backend.DataQuery{
{
JSON: []byte(`{
"queryType": "Azure Resource Graph",
"azureResourceGraph": {
"query": "resources | where $__contains(name,'res1','res2')",
"resultFormat": "table"
}
}`),
RefID: "A",
},
},
azureResourceGraphQueries: []*AzureResourceGraphQuery{
{
RefID: "A",
ResultFormat: "table",
URL: "",
JSON: []byte(`{
"queryType": "Azure Resource Graph",
"azureResourceGraph": {
"query": "resources | where $__contains(name,'res1','res2')",
"resultFormat": "table"
}
}`),
InterpolatedQuery: "resources | where ['name'] in ('res1','res2')",
},
},
Err: require.NoError,
},
}
for _, tt := range tests {
t.Run(tt.name, func(t *testing.T) {
queries, err := datasource.buildQueries(tt.queryModel, types.DatasourceInfo{})
tt.Err(t, err)
if diff := cmp.Diff(tt.azureResourceGraphQueries, queries, cmpopts.IgnoreUnexported(struct{}{})); diff != "" {
t.Errorf("Result mismatch (-want +got):\n%s", diff)
}
})
}
}
func TestAzureResourceGraphCreateRequest(t *testing.T) {
ctx := context.Background()
url := "http://ds"
tests := []struct {
name string
expectedURL string
expectedHeaders http.Header
Err require.ErrorAssertionFunc
}{
{
name: "creates a request",
expectedURL: "http://ds/",
expectedHeaders: http.Header{
"Content-Type": []string{"application/json"},
},
Err: require.NoError,
},
}
for _, tt := range tests {
t.Run(tt.name, func(t *testing.T) {
ds := AzureResourceGraphDatasource{}
req, err := ds.createRequest(ctx, []byte{}, url)
tt.Err(t, err)
if req.URL.String() != tt.expectedURL {
t.Errorf("Expecting %s, got %s", tt.expectedURL, req.URL.String())
}
if !cmp.Equal(req.Header, tt.expectedHeaders) {
t.Errorf("Unexpected HTTP headers: %v", cmp.Diff(req.Header, tt.expectedHeaders))
}
})
}
}
func TestAddConfigData(t *testing.T) {
field := data.Field{}
dataLink := data.DataLink{Title: "View query in Azure Portal", TargetBlank: true, URL: "http://ds"}
frame := data.Frame{
Fields: []*data.Field{&field},
}
frameWithLink := loganalytics.AddConfigLinks(frame, "http://ds", nil)
expectedFrameWithLink := data.Frame{
Fields: []*data.Field{
{
Config: &data.FieldConfig{
Links: []data.DataLink{dataLink},
},
},
},
}
if !cmp.Equal(frameWithLink, expectedFrameWithLink, data.FrameTestCompareOptions()...) {
t.Errorf("unexpepcted frame: %v", cmp.Diff(frameWithLink, expectedFrameWithLink, data.FrameTestCompareOptions()...))
}
}
func TestUnmarshalResponse400(t *testing.T) {
datasource := &AzureResourceGraphDatasource{}
res, err := datasource.unmarshalResponse(&http.Response{
StatusCode: 400,
Status: "400 Bad Request",
Body: io.NopCloser(strings.NewReader(("Azure Error Message"))),
})
expectedErrMsg := "400 Bad Request. Azure Resource Graph error: Azure Error Message"
assert.Equal(t, expectedErrMsg, err.Error())
assert.Empty(t, res)
}
func TestUnmarshalResponse200Invalid(t *testing.T) {
datasource := &AzureResourceGraphDatasource{}
res, err := datasource.unmarshalResponse(&http.Response{
StatusCode: 200,
Status: "OK",
Body: io.NopCloser(strings.NewReader(("Azure Data"))),
})
expectedRes := AzureResourceGraphResponse{}
expectedErr := "invalid character 'A' looking for beginning of value"
assert.Equal(t, expectedErr, err.Error())
assert.Equal(t, expectedRes, res)
}
func TestUnmarshalResponse200(t *testing.T) {
datasource := &AzureResourceGraphDatasource{}
res, err2 := datasource.unmarshalResponse(&http.Response{
StatusCode: 200,
Status: "OK",
Body: io.NopCloser(strings.NewReader("{}")),
})
expectedRes := AzureResourceGraphResponse{}
assert.NoError(t, err2)
assert.Equal(t, expectedRes, res)
}
